CHANGE OF USE OF ATRIUM SPACES
Submission of plans for approval
Fire-based shows / “open-flame” cooking activities /
pyrotechnic displays, are required to consult SCDF on the
fire safety conditions & obtain separate approval
No hazardous and toxic materials (e.g. LPG, flammable
gases)
Crowd control measures
Designed occupancy load of building cannot be exceeded

PRIVATE SALES
Closing of roller shutters at entrances/ exits to limit
access to shopping area
o Impedes evacuation during emergencies
Crowd Control measures
o Stationing wardens at entrances at all times
Display directional signs and instructions to inform public

NON MAINTENANCE OF FS MEASURES
False Alarm / Malfunction
‘The boy who cried wolf’
Occupants becoming complacent to frequent false alarm
activations
Hampers evacuation process
False Alarm/ Malfunction
Servicing of fire alarm system i.e. heat/ smoke detectors,
sprinkler systems
Isolating zone during construction work and re-arming alarm
system once work completed for the day
o Need to ensure zone fully monitored for fire/ incident
during temporary isolation
